Technical Context
The UCLAMP0511P.TCT uses a surge-rated FET as its primary protection element, activated by a precision trigger circuit that initiates conduction when transient voltage exceeds breakdown. Unlike conventional TVS diodes, its clamping voltage remains nearly constant across 0–24A peak pulse current due to decreasing RDS(on) under surge conditions.
It features 175pF junction capacitance at 5V reverse bias, 130–600nA leakage at VRWM = 5V, and a 7.5V clamping voltage under 1.2/50μs–8/20μs combination waveform (RS = 2Ω). Its functional architecture enables stable protection for 5V bus lines without thermal derating penalties seen in standard TVS devices.

Can UCLAMP0511P.TCT be used on USB 3.0 or USB 3.1 SuperSpeed differential pairs?
No, UCLAMP0511P.TCT is not suitable for USB 3.x SuperSpeed lanes. Its 175pF junction capacitance introduces excessive signal distortion and insertion loss on 5Gbps+ differential signals. For those lines, Semtech recommends low-capacitance arrays like RClamp3371ZC (<0.25pF). UCLAMP0511P.TCT is intended for 5V VBUS, CC, or power-related single-ended lines - not high-speed data paths.
How does UCLAMP0511P.TCT achieve flat clamping voltage across varying surge currents?
UCLAMP0511P.TCT uses a surge-rated FET activated by a precision trigger circuit. As surge current increases, the FET's RDS(on) decreases, counteracting voltage rise - resulting in near-constant clamping (7.5V from 1A to 24A). This behavior, documented in the UCLAMP0511P.TCT datasheet's Typical Characteristics section, differs fundamentally from TVS diodes whose VC = VBR + IPP × RDYN.
